Output ef8334039df7bfc205eaf2034450ed7bde1d2c812281bf3956715924d7c4e9ee:3

value
52597
script pubkey
OP_0 OP_PUSHBYTES_32 c5dac3656b4590ddad26c42af871a44c1c8ef76539ce220b44d21d78a518ca7a
address
bc1qchdvxettgkgdmtfxcs40sudyfswgaam9888zyz6y6gwh3fgcefaq9r7trx
transaction
ef8334039df7bfc205eaf2034450ed7bde1d2c812281bf3956715924d7c4e9ee